Step 1: Be a Scholarly Superhero (or at least look like one)

GPA: This one's a biggie. Georgia Tech is looking for students who can handle the academic heat. Aim for a GPA that would make your parents shed a single, proud tear (and maybe brag to their friends a little). Think straight A's, or at least darn close.

Test Scores (if required): While Georgia Tech is moving towards a more holistic admissions process, strong test scores can still be your secret weapon. If you're required to submit them, dedicate some serious time to SAT/ACT prep. Visualize yourself conquering those tests like a ninja conquering...well, something very conquerable.

Coursework: Don't just take classes, devour them! Show Georgia Tech you have a thirst for knowledge by taking the most rigorous courses your school offers, especially in math and science. Step 3: The Interview (Deep Breaths, You Got This!)

Stay Calm and Carry On: Interviews can be nerve-wracking, but remember, the admissions committee wants to see you succeed. Be yourself, be enthusiastic, and show them why Georgia Tech is your perfect academic match.

Practice Makes Perfect: Don't wing it! Prepare for common interview questions and rehearse your answers out loud. You'll sound confident and, more importantly, avoid rambling about your goldfish's newfound appreciation for geometry (unless that's actually how you landed that internship at NASA).
